Freaky suspenseful and intriguing British movie about a car crash with unexpected side effects
20 December 2020
While executive Roger Moore finds under critical condition on the operation table later a car crash , his alter-ego emerges and turns his happy, lucky life -along with wife Hildegard Neil , and children- into a real nightmare. As we follow in tension to the unfortunate Moore in his attempt to solve the twisted puzzle, while receiving advises from his psychiatrist : Freddie Jones . His Life is Upset ! . Stalked by fear and terror night and day !. You will live every shattering moment of terror with... The man Who Haunted Himself.

This one seems to be an expanded rendition of an episode of Rod Serling's "Twilight Zone" or the TV series "Alfred Hitchcock presents" . An exciting picture mixing palm-sweeting intrigue, bizarre events, thrills , chills , plot twists and dull stretches. The plot is plain and simple, recovering from a car wreck , a man starts questioning his sanity when it shows up his exact doppleganger assuming his position in the world. As it appeals primarily to those fascinated for these popular series where mystery matters most . This was Roger Moore's first movie after having starred in the TV series The Saint . Moore provides perhaps his best screen acting in this interesting and attractive film about a wealthy man who finds his life being taken by a double. He is well accompanied by a fine support cast, such as Hildegard Nell , Olga Georges Picot , Anton Rodger , Thorley Walters , Laurence Hardy, Edward Chapman, John Welsh, and special mention for Freddie Jones as a pill-swallowing, switching psychologist, among others

It displays a thrilling and moving musical score by Michael J. Lewis. As well as appropriate and functional cinematography by Spratling, completely filmed in London. This imaginative Chiller-Thriller picture was compellingly directed by Basil Dearden, being his last film, in fact he died by car accident the following year . He was a good craftsman , directing nice films through a long career, such as : The assassination bureau, Masquerade, The League of Gentlemen, The smallest show on Earth, Karthoum , Sapphire , Dead of night, Captive Heart , The ship that died of Shame, Victim , All night long, Only when I larf, The Square Ring, Train of events , Out of the Clouds , They came to a City , Halfway House, Pool of London, Gentle Gunman and TV series as Persuaders , among others . Rating 6.5/10. Well worth watching due to keep the spectator involved from start to finish .
